在数字化时代,内容分发速度对于用户体验至关重要,CDN(Content Delivery Network,内容分发网络)通过将内容缓存至靠近用户的服务器上,有效减少了数据传输的延迟,提高了访问速度,尤其对于大型文件的下载与上传过程有着显著的影响,但配置CDN后,其对文件上传速度的影响也是值得探讨的话题。
1、CDN工作原理:
CDN通过将网站内容分发至全球范围内的加速节点,使用户可以就近获取所需内容。
减少因网络拥堵、跨运营商等问题引起的延迟,降低响应时间,提升下载速度。
2、CDN对下载速度的影响:
静态内容,如图片、视频等,是CDN缓存加速的主要对象。
动态内容由于每次请求可能得到不同的结果,不适宜用CDN进行缓存加速。
3、影响CDN下载速度的因素:
预热机制,即事先将文件缓存到CDN节点,是实现快速下载的关键步骤。
未经预热的文件,在用户首次请求时可能会出现下载缓慢的情况。
4、CDN对上传速度的影响:
分段上传策略,通过将文件分成小块并行上传到不同CDN节点,可以显著提高上传效率。
大文件传输时,CDN的高带宽优势可以减少上传过程中的延迟现象。
5、CDN优化建议:
选择合适的CDN服务商,考虑其节点覆盖范围和服务质量。
对经常访问的内容实施预热策略,确保快速响应用户请求。
CDN的配置不仅可以加速文件的下载速度,而且通过采用适当的策略,如分段上传,也能在一定程度上加速文件的上传速度,需要注意的是,CDN的核心优势在于加速静态内容的分发,并且其效果受到多种因素的影响,在选择和配置CDN服务时,应充分了解其工作机制及优化方法,以期达到最佳的加速效果。
相关问答FAQs
Q1: CDN是否对所有类型的内容都能提供加速效果?
A1: 不是,CDN主要针对静态内容提供加速效果,例如图片、视频文件等,动态内容由于每次请求的结果可能不同,一般不适合使用CDN加速。
Q2: 如何确保CDN达到最佳加速效果?
A2: 确保最佳加速效果需要对CDN进行正确配置,包括选择合适的CDN服务商、实施内容预热策略、优化缓存设置等,定期监控CDN性能并根据反馈调整配置也是保证加速效果的重要环节。
上一篇:华为g750t01进不了系统